Abstract A description is provided for Saccobolus truncatus . Almost all records of this species are on dung of herbivorous mammals, but the type material was stated to be on raven droppings, and there are also records on mushroom compost and a mushroom-growing bed and pig dung. Some information on its habitat, dispersal and transmission, and conservation status is given, along with details of its geographical distribution (Africa (Kenya, Morocco), North America (Canada (Manitoba, Ontario), USA (Colorado, Florida, New York, Virginia)), South America (Argentina, Brazil (Mato Grosso do Sul, Pernambuco), Chile, Peru), Asia (Armenia, China (Beijing, Yunnan), India (Himachal Pradesh, Uttarakhand), Israel, Japan, Nepal, Pakistan, Taiwan, Tajikistan, Thailand), Atlantic Ocean (Spain (Canary Islands)), Caribbean (Dominica, Guadeloupe, Puerto Rico, Saba (Caribbean Netherlands), St Lucia), Europe (Austria, Belgium, Bulgaria, Czech Republic, Denmark, Estonia, France, Italy, Germany, Moldova, Netherlands, Poland, Russia (Kursk Oblast, Leningrad Oblast, Republic of Mordovia), Ukraine, UK)). The present species has been included in studies of wheat straw lignin and cellulose modification by fungal colonists of herbivore dung, to explore the possibility that their anticipated ability to decompose lignocellulosic residues could be used to upgrade the nutritional value of animal feed.
